Currently it's only possible to have multiple extensions on the same folder if they are all in separate folders, including the main one, if any.

When we scan for extension items, we could exclude other extensions folder to allow an extension to have sub extensions.

The drawbacks ok this is that they still can't be on the same flat folder since items would be scanned for both.

Maybe just document that Choko allows multiple extensions on same folder if:

  • they are all in separate folders, including the main one, if any
  • they are all on the same flat folder if they don't have items (discouraged)
